Population

There is a lot of data that lets us see how many people live in Florence, Oregon. The most basic data is the total population, which is the total number of people living in Florence, Oregon. The estimated population of Florence, Oregon is 9,353 people, with a median age of 60.4.

Median Household Income

The latest median household income of Florence, Oregon is $50,615.00.

In simple terms, the median income is the middle income of a group of people. Half of the people in the group make more than the median income, and half make less. The median income is a good indicator of the overall income of a group of people, and can be used to compare against other metrics such as the average income, per capita income, and more.

Average Household Income

Whenever we ask what is the average household income in Florence, we are actually talking about the mean household income.

This is calculated by adding up all the incomes of all the households in Florence, and then dividing that number by the total number of households. This is a good way to get a general idea of the average income of a group of people, but it can be skewed by a very high or very low incomes.

The average household income of Florence, Oregon is currently $65,469.00.

In terms of accurately summarizing income at a geographic level, the median income is a better metric than the average income because it isn't affected by a small number of very high or very low incomes.

If you had an area where the average income was greater than the median, it can mean that there is significant income inequality, with income being concentrated in a small number of wealthy households.

3.61% of households in Florence are classed as high income households (making $200,000+ per year).

Per Capita Income

The per capita income in Florence is $33,256.00.

Per capita income is the average income of a person in a given area. It is calculated by dividing the total income of Florence by the total population of Florence.

This is different from the average or mean income because it includes and accounts for all people in Florence, Oregon, including people like children, the elderly, unemployed people, retired people, and more.

Employment

Employment rates are all based around the total population in Florence that are over the age of 16.

The total population of Florence over the age of 16 is 8,328.

Of those people, a total of 37.10% are working or actively looking for work. This is called the labor force participation rate.

The participation rate is a useful market measure because it shows the relative amount of labor resources available to the economy.

The employment to total population rate in Florence is 35.00%.

Households and Family Size

A household defined bu the US Census Bureau is a group of people who occupy a housing unit. A housing unit is a house, apartment, mobile home, group of rooms, or single room occupied as separate living quarters.

There are currently 4,714 households in Florence, with an average household size of 1.97 people.

A family is defined as a group of two or more people related by birth, marriage, or adoption who live together in the same household.

There are 2,559 families in Florence with an average family size of 2.47 people.

Housing

There are 5,293 housing units in Florence, Oregon.

The table below shows the split between occupied and vacant units:

Total Percentage
Occupied 4,714 89.06%
Vacant 579 10.94%

30.76% of the total 5,293 housing units in Florence are rental units. This is approximately 1,628 properties.

For owner-occupied housing units, a total of 3,050 are occupied by the owner - or 57.62% of the total.

Rental Rates

The median rent for a property in Florence is $1,028.00.
